What Is Clinical Competency and Why Does It Dominate the CMA Exam?
If you have looked at the CMA Exam Domains 2026: Complete Guide to All 3 Content Areas, you already know the exam is divided into three domains: Clinical Competency at 59%, General at 21%, and Administrative at 20%. Those percentages are not arbitrary. They reflect what certified medical assistants actually do in practice - and the majority of a CMA's daily responsibilities are clinical in nature.
The Certifying Board of the American Association of Medical Assistants (AAMA) designs the exam to mirror real-world job performance. That means the exam's largest domain is weighted precisely because clinical tasks - patient preparation, specimen collection, medication administration, infection control, diagnostic procedures - are where errors have the most direct impact on patient safety. Understanding this context reframes how you should study. Domain 1 is not just the biggest section; it is the section where competence is most consequential.

Inside Domain 1: What Clinical Competency Actually Covers
The AAMA Content Outline organizes Clinical Competency into distinct subcategories. Candidates who treat Domain 1 as a single monolithic block inevitably discover gaps when they sit down to test. Breaking it into its component parts - and studying each component deliberately - is the more effective approach.
Domain 1: Clinical Competency - Core Subcategory Areas
The AAMA Content Outline structures clinical content across multiple practice areas. Expect questions drawn from all of the following:
- Patient Preparation and Care: Vital signs, medical history taking, positioning and draping, patient communication during procedures
- Infection Control and Safety: Standard precautions, transmission-based precautions, PPE selection and removal, OSHA regulations, biohazard disposal
- Pharmacology and Medication Administration: Drug classifications, routes of administration, dosage calculation principles, prescription interpretation, immunization schedules
- Specimen Collection and Processing: Venipuncture, capillary puncture, urine collection methods, chain of custody, specimen handling and labeling
- Diagnostic Procedures: ECG/EKG preparation and artifact identification, spirometry, vision and hearing screenings, radiology safety
- Minor Surgical Procedures: Instrument identification, sterile field preparation, wound care, suture and staple removal
- Emergency Preparedness: Triage principles, first aid, CPR awareness, crash cart contents, recognition of life-threatening conditions
- Patient Education: Health coaching, disease prevention, culturally competent instruction, teach-back method
Each of these areas carries its own vocabulary, its own set of procedures, and its own set of legal and ethical boundaries. A candidate who is strong in phlebotomy but weak in pharmacology, for example, is still leaving a significant number of potential points on the table.
High-Priority Clinical Topics You Cannot Afford to Skip
Infection Control: High Frequency, High Stakes
Infection control questions appear throughout the clinical domain, not just in one isolated cluster. Standard precautions apply to every patient interaction. Transmission-based precautions - contact, droplet, and airborne - require candidates to know the specific PPE required for each, the diseases associated with each category, and the sequence for donning and doffing equipment. OSHA's Bloodborne Pathogen Standard is testable material, including the exposure control plan, post-exposure protocols, and required employee training timelines.
Key Takeaway
Infection control is not a single topic to check off - it runs as a thread through patient preparation, specimen handling, surgical assist, and emergency response questions. Learn the principles once, then apply them across every clinical scenario you study.
Pharmacology: The Area Candidates Underestimate
Pharmacology questions on the CMA exam go beyond memorizing drug names. Candidates must understand drug classifications (Schedule I through V controlled substances), routes of administration and their clinical indications, basic principles of dosage calculation (including pediatric weight-based calculations), and how to read and interpret a prescription. Immunization schedules - particularly the CDC childhood immunization schedule - are fair game. So are drug interactions at a conceptual level and the medical assistant's scope of practice regarding medication administration.
Many candidates underinvest here because pharmacology feels like "nursing content." It is not - it is explicitly CMA content, and it appears consistently across exam administrations.
Venipuncture and Specimen Collection
Phlebotomy is a procedural strength for many candidates who completed hands-on externships, but the written exam tests the procedural knowledge differently. Expect questions on order of draw (the sequence in which collection tubes must be filled to prevent cross-contamination of additives), tube color and additive identification, troubleshooting failed venipuncture attempts, patient identification protocols, and correct specimen labeling and storage. Capillary puncture technique, appropriate sites by patient age, and microcollection container selection are also tested.
ECG/EKG Interpretation Basics
The CMA exam does not require candidates to diagnose complex arrhythmias - that is outside the scope of the credential. However, candidates must be able to identify a normal sinus rhythm, recognize obvious artifacts (patient movement, loose leads, 60-cycle interference), know the standard lead placement for a 12-lead ECG, and understand the basic components of the cardiac cycle as represented on the tracing (P wave, QRS complex, T wave). Preparation and patient education for the procedure are also tested.
How Clinical Questions Are Written on the CMA Exam
The CMA exam uses 200 multiple-choice questions, of which 180 are scored and 20 are unscored pretested items distributed throughout the exam. You will not know which questions are pretest items, so treat every question as scored.
Clinical questions in Domain 1 are predominantly scenario-based. Rather than asking "What is the order of draw?" directly, a question might describe a patient encounter with specific tube requirements and ask which sequence the CMA should follow. This scenario format tests application, not just recall. It rewards candidates who understand the why behind procedures, not just the steps.
| Question Style | What It Tests | Example Trigger |
|---|---|---|
| Direct knowledge recall | Terminology, definitions, classifications | "Which of the following is a Schedule II controlled substance?" |
| Application/scenario | Procedure steps, clinical decision-making | "A patient's ECG shows 60-cycle interference. What is the most likely cause?" |
| Priority/best action | Scope of practice, safety hierarchy | "Which action should the CMA take first when a patient reports chest pain during a procedure?" |
| Patient education | Communication, health literacy, instructions | "A patient does not understand the instructions for a 24-hour urine collection. What is the CMA's best response?" |

The exam is delivered by PSI either in-person at a PSI test center or via PSI Live Remote Proctoring following AAMA approval. The 160 minutes of exam time is divided into four 40-minute segments with optional breaks available between segments. This structure means you will encounter clinical questions across multiple segments - fatigue in later segments is real, and your clinical accuracy should not drop in segment three or four.
Scoring Context: What 59% Really Means for Your Result
The CMA exam uses a scaled scoring system with a minimum passing score of 405 on a 200-800 scale. Raw scores are converted to scaled scores, which account for slight difficulty variations between exam forms. What this means practically: you do not need to answer every clinical question correctly, but you need to answer enough of them correctly - consistently - to land at or above 405.
The AAMA reported a 69% first-time pass rate for administrations from July 2024 to April 2025. That figure means roughly 31% of first-time candidates do not pass. Most post-exam analysis points to Domain 1 underperformance as a primary driver of failures - not because candidates neglect clinical content entirely, but because they study it at the surface level when the exam demands application-level mastery.

Common Clinical Competency Mistakes That Sink Candidates
Studying Procedures Without Studying the Why
Many candidates memorize the steps of venipuncture or ECG lead placement without understanding the rationale behind each step. The exam exploits this. A question that describes a step out of sequence - and asks what error the CMA made - requires you to understand the purpose of each step, not just its position in the list. Always ask yourself: why does this step come before that one? What patient safety issue does this sequence prevent?
Ignoring Scope of Practice Questions
Scope of practice questions are not opinion questions - they have objectively correct answers based on what CMAs are legally and professionally authorized to do. Candidates who blur the line between CMA and RN scope frequently miss these questions. When a clinical scenario presents a situation where a patient needs something the CMA cannot legally provide, the correct answer almost always involves notifying the supervising provider, not taking independent action.
Underweighting Patient Education as a Clinical Skill
Patient education sits within Domain 1 because it is a clinical skill, not an administrative courtesy. Questions in this area test whether candidates know how to assess a patient's health literacy, adapt instructions to the patient's level of understanding, and confirm comprehension using the teach-back method. These questions are frequently skipped over during preparation because they feel less "technical" - and that is exactly why they trip candidates up on exam day.
Skipping Practice Questions in Favor of Re-Reading Notes
Re-reading creates familiarity, not mastery. Familiarity with clinical content does not translate to correct answers on scenario-based questions. The only way to build the application skill the exam requires is to practice applying it - repeatedly, under timed conditions, with immediate review of rationales.
